37 lines
990 B
Plaintext
37 lines
990 B
Plaintext
# =============================================================================
|
|
# Wallet Payment Server - Environment Configuration
|
|
# =============================================================================
|
|
# Copy this to .env and fill in values:
|
|
# cp .env.example .env
|
|
# Or deploy to: /home/intaleq-walletintaleq/env/.env
|
|
# =============================================================================
|
|
|
|
# Database
|
|
dbname=WalletIntaleqDB
|
|
USER=root
|
|
PASS=<CHANGE_ME>
|
|
|
|
# JWT / Security
|
|
SECRET_KEY=<CHANGE_ME>
|
|
SECRET_KEY_HMAC=<CHANGE_ME>
|
|
FP_PEPPER=<CHANGE_ME>
|
|
S2S_SHARED_KEY=<CHANGE_ME>
|
|
PAYMENT_KEY=<CHANGE_ME>
|
|
WEBHOOK_AUTH_TOKEN=<CHANGE_ME>
|
|
CRON_KEY=<CHANGE_ME>
|
|
|
|
# Encryption
|
|
keyOfApp=<32_byte_hex>
|
|
initializationVector=<16_byte_hex>
|
|
|
|
# Gemini AI (receipt analysis)
|
|
GEMINI_API_KEY=<CHANGE_ME>
|
|
|
|
# Nabeh Integration (must match Nabeh's .env)
|
|
NABEH_API_KEY=<CHANGE_ME_SHARED_SECRET>
|
|
|
|
# Admin login
|
|
passwordnewpassenger=<CHANGE_ME>
|
|
allowedWallet1=Tripz-Wallet
|
|
allowedWallet2=Intaleq-Wallet
|